[QUOTE="Pushrodsnake, post: 1132729, member: 17955"] I've never actually purchased a catback kit for any of my cars. I've always just pieced together a catback from parts that I specifically choose. I did the upswept tailpipes on my '02 GT and my '95 Cobra. Ford had it right with those tailpipes and they should have kept doing them. The '02 GT had Flowmaster original 40s, 2.5" flow tubes made by the exhaust shop, and fox body LX tailpipes with 3.5x18" Magnaflow rolled-edge tips (longest I could install with the available length of the tailpipe before the first bend near the front of the gas tank). [IMG]http://i729.photobucket.com/albums/ww295/jonny_crash/2002%20Mustang/DSCN0765_zps2d99f617.jpg[/IMG] [IMG]http://i729.photobucket.com/albums/ww295/jonny_crash/2002%20Mustang/DSCN0754_zpsfdf2f73f.jpg[/IMG] [IMG]http://i729.photobucket.com/albums/ww295/jonny_crash/2002%20Mustang/DSCN0766_zps5a3ee22c.jpg[/IMG] The Cobra has the same fabricated flow tubes and LX tailpipes, with the exception of Spintech Sportsman 3000XL series mufflers (which I'm going to replace eventually since they're too large to tuck up as neatly as I want them to) and Gibson 3x18" tips. I bought the really cheap Dynomax 2.5" mandrel-bent tailpipes off of Summit Racing. Dynomax is manufactured by Walker Exhaust (which makes OEM applications for just about everything), so they fit very well.
